Phyllis R. Carrozza, 72, of Manchester, beloved wife of Charles Carrozza, passed away Friday, Aug. 5, 2016, at St. Francis Hospital.Born in Brooklyn, New York, Phyllis was the daughter of the late Sebastian and Nancy (Cappiello) Scibelli, and was also predeceased by her two brothers.In addition...
